Students holding Bachelor’s degree in following discipline can apply for the program: Science, Engineering, Economics, Mathematics, Statistics, Geology and Geography
Admission to the M Sc programmes is made on the basis of an online test and interview conducted by the Deemed University. Applications are invited from the candidates by advertising the programmes in some leading newspapers every year.
The prospect of climate change is a pressing environmental concern with implications on energy, water resources, agriculture and food security, ecosystems and biodiversity, coastal zones, and human health.
Addressing climate change requires a good scientific understanding, as well as coordinated actions and policies at the local, national, and global levels. This intensive four-semester programme, aims to provide students and future professionals practical and theoretical knowledge of the science and policy of issues relevant to climate change.
